Announcing Swimm’s IDE plugin: The most intuitive way to document code
Blog post from Swimm
Swimm has released a significant update to its IDE plugins for VS Code and JetBrains, enhancing the integration of documentation within the development environment to streamline workflows and improve efficiency. This update allows developers to create and edit documentation directly in the IDE using a rich-text editor, facilitating the documentation process as code is written without the need to switch tools. The new features include the ability to browse code and documentation simultaneously, with Swimm documents incorporating live code elements, charts, and diagrams that automatically update with local code modifications. The patented Auto-sync feature keeps documentation current within the IDE, alerting developers to changes affecting existing documentation even before changes are pushed. This innovative integration aims to address the inefficiency highlighted by an HBR study, which found that developers spend significant time reorienting themselves after switching between apps. Swimm's CTO, Omer Rosenbaum, emphasized the transformative nature of this update and encouraged user feedback to enhance the tool further.
